Participates in numerous and varying activities relating to the negotiation, implementation, and administration of tax conventions and other international tax agreements to which the United States is a party, and legislation, regulations, policies, and procedures impacting thereon. Develops and presents complete plans for activities assigned, and coordinates projects, program segments, and procedures relating to assigned tax treaty programs and activities. Participates in formal or informal studies or projects, either on own initiative or as directed; formulating proposals, and making recommendations on priorities, scope, timing, and techniques for consideration and decision by superiors. Implements plans and prepares draft documents, technical material and other guidance relating to ongoing Competent Authority programs, or in order to implement new Competent Authority programs. Prepares background packages and/or position papers for use by others in matters involving the administration of tax treaties and other international agreements in the compliance area.

You must meet the following requirements by the time of referral: SPECIALIZED EXPERIENCE GRADE 14: To qualify for the grade 14 level, you must have at least one year of specialized experience equivalent to the GS-13 which is the next lower grade level of the normal line of progression of this position in the Federal government. Specialized experience is experience that is related to the work of this position and has provided you with the competencies required for successful job performance.Qualifying experience is experience that demonstrated accomplishment of legal, tax accounting, or other project assignments that required a wide range of knowledge of Federal tax laws, regulations, precedent decisions, or other areas related to the position to be filled. This knowledge is generally demonstrated by assignments where the applicant analyzed a number of alternative approaches in the process of advising management concerning major aspects of Federal tax laws, regulations, and precedent decisions. Examples of qualifying specialized experience include: Prepare legal memoranda, review or draft rulings, determination or advisory letters related to Federal taxation. Analyze and adjudicate tax claims, appeals, settlement offers, or similar work related to Federal tax operations. Conduct legal research and analysis and prepare briefs or similar documents that interpret laws and regulations. As an accountant, a tax preparer, a financial manager, auditor, or investigator conduct work that requires application of Federal tax accounting principles and/or the Internal Revenue Code and related laws.
